QolorPIX® Tape Controller, Eight Output
City Theatrical's QolorPIX® Tape Controller, Eight Output (P/N 5850) is preconfigured with personality profiles that can be combined and adjusted to produce thousands of dynamic effects with Q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ape using only a few DMX channels. Any lighting effect you can imagine - chases, fades, scrolls, bursts, and more - can be created in minutes.
The QolorPIX Tape Controller offers eight ports, which accommodate a total of 40 meters of Q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ape. A user friendly control interface allows you to change mode, pixel length, dimmer, personality start address, strip type, fixture ID, and direction. The controller features an integrated power supply, a test function and flicker finder for easy troubleshooting. It also offers wireless DMX control using state of the art Multiverse® technology.

Additional Information
- Supports ANSI E1.11 DMX512-A
- Compatible with QolorPIX LED Tape
- Effects engine enables controlling enitre length of QolorPIX Tape with only 12 or 24 DMX Addresses
- Eight output ports individual pixels on each port
- Firmware is user updateable through micro-SD card slot
- Controllable via DMX512-A, recordable presets, and test routine
- DMX512 control through effects engine, RGB, and pixel address modes
- Can be mounted in a standard 19-inch rack with included mounting accessories. Requires 2U rack spaces
FAQs About Q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ape
SPECS:
Q1. How much tape is on each reel of Q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A1. 5 Meters (16.4 feet)
Q2. What are the cutting increments of Q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A2. You can cut the tape between each LED, or 21mm.
Q3. What is the voltage of Q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A3. QolorPIX tape operates at 5 volts.
Q4. How many LEDs per meter are on Q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ape? How many LEDs per reel?
A4. There are 48 LEDs per meter and 240 LEDs per reel.
Q5. Is Q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ape IP rated for outdoor use?
A5. Yes, Q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ape is IP67 rated.
Q6. What is the chipset for Q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A6. QolorPIX tape uses standard chipset WS2812B.
Q7. What is the part number for Q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A7. Q5050-5-RGB-48-5-67-2
SET UP:
Q8. How can I mount Q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A8. Plastic mounting clips are included with each reel of tape.
Q9. Can I play media on Q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A9. Yes, since the tape uses a standard chipset, you can use it with a media server to play video or media.
Q10. What length are the extrusions for Q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A10. City Theatrical sells two different aluminum extrusions, Part# 6691 and Part #6692, which both fit QolorPIX tape. Part#6691 is 9mm high and Part# 6692 is 14mm high. They are both sold in 2 meter lengths.
Q11. Can Q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ape be diffused?
A11. Yes, you can diffuse QolorPIX tape. When diffused, the effects take on a completely different look. City Theatrical sells two different diffusers (Part# 6696 and Part# 6697) that fit perfectly with the extrusion Part# 6691 and Part# 6692. The diffusers are sold in 2 meter lengths.
Q12. Are there 12V and 24V versions of Q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A12. No, we currently only offer 5V tape.
NEXT STEPS:
Q13. Can I control every pixel on Q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A13. Yes, you can control every pixel up to one universe (512 slots). Although this is possible, it is quite limiting. Each pixel requires 3 slots (red, green, blue). This means an entire universe can only control 170 pixels, not a full roll.
Q14. Can I use Q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ape that I have cut?
A14. Yes, the cut pieces of the tape can be used by soldering leads onto the copper pads.
Q15. Does City Theatrical offer different types of pixel tape?
A15. No, City Theatrical currently offers only one type of pixel tape, Part# Q5050-5-RGB-48-5-67-2. (The tape has 48 LEDs per meter, 5 meters in length, black backing, it is encapsulated in clear rectangular silicone tubing making it IP67 rated, it has a 4pin XLR connector on one end and it uses chipset WS2812B.)
Q16. Can I extend the reels of Q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ape?
A16. No. If you are using the Q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ape with City Theatrical’s QolorPIX Tape Controller, you should not extend the reel beyond 5 meters (240 LEDs) since each port on the Tape Controller can only drive one reel of tape.

QolorPIX Pixel Control at the Vince Lombardi Trophy Replica Lighting at Super Bowl Live in Atlanta, Georgia |
Working under an exceptionally tight timeline, the RMRK creative production agency was looking for a turn-key pixel tape and controller solution to add dynamic lighting to the iconic Vince Lombardi Trophy replica, an outdoor 25-foot statue which was the backdrop for Super Bowl LIII events before and after the game in Atlanta, Georgia. The trophy’s pixel controlled LED lighting solution would need to be programmable, such that it could coordinate with musical performances by Atlanta-based artists like Jermaine Dupri and Ludacris. The ideal pixel-based lighting solution would offer plug and play installation and operation using industry standard XLR extensions. The RMRK team chose City Theatrical’s Q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ape and Tape Controller as the solution to provide plug and play pixel effects over the trophy’s sides, shield, and football seams. With overnight delivery and 4-pin XLRM connectors soldered to the end of each reel of QolorPIX tape, the team was able to quickly and easily install and program this pixel control solution. “QolorPIX solved many of our challenges – weather, controller distance, brightness – with a single, off-the-shelf solution. ” - Rob Kodadek, Co-Founder & Executive Creative Director, RMRK |

QolorPIX Tree Lighting at the Christmas Spectacular at Baptist Falls Church Menomonee Falls, Wisconsin |
Falls Baptist Church was looking for a way to enhance the lighting of their annual Christmas Spectacular event, with performances that attract and inspire thousands of people from the surrounding communities. With the help of a new professional lighting designer as part of their creative team, they developed ideas to illuminate the stage and over 100 performers with dynamic lighting effects. The lighting designer looked for a foundational lighting element that could be used throughout the entire show. Since the scenic design was minimal, there were limited options when it came to building in lighting fixtures that could support each musical movement. Pixel tape seemed to be a practical solution, but the team needed tape that was easy to install and use, and could play throughout the show without repeating an effect. Six reels of QolorPIX Pixel Controlled LED Tape, driven by an ETC ION console to the QolorPIX Tape Controller, worked as the unique lighting solution to dynamically light three Christmas Trees with color and dimension, with plug and play effects ranging from one and two color paparazzi, comets, and beyond. “QolorPIX was so easy work with. Within an hour, I was able to control the pixel tape and record multiple presets.” - Derek Welker, Freelance Lighting Designer, Falls Baptist Church |
